The Department of Special Services is looking for a dynamic, licensed Speech-Language Pathologist who has experience providing therapy with middle school students on the spectrum and those with developmental disabilities for a leave replacement position from on or about June 1, 2026, through January 21, 2027. Experience with the integrated model is a strength. We use a multidisciplinary approach, which emphasizes teamwork, communication, and collaboration. New Jersey certification required. Services include individual, group, push-in and pull-out settings dependent on the child's IEP. Evaluations of students for speech services is another requirement.
The following experiences are an integral part of the position:
Experience with PROMPT therapy
Use of AAC devices
Determining appropriate speech therapy treatment plans through documented evaluations and consultations
Consistently providing only the highest quality of speech therapy service
Maintaining an in-depth knowledge of all State regulations pertaining to the services provided
Collaborate with staff in developing a comprehensive plan to provide activities and support to meet the speech and language learning goals.
Communicate effectively with parents about progress and home support
Experience logging of SEMI services
